SSL证书安装指南 轻松搞定网站安全
网站安装SSL证书麻烦吗?

安装SSL证书对于保护网站数据传输的安全性至关重要。然而,许多人担心这个过程是否复杂或耗时。实际上,随着技术的进步,安装SSL证书已经变得相对简单。下面我们将详细介绍如何下载SSL证书以及如何在网站上成功安装它。
SSL证书下载到本地最简单方法是什么?
步骤一 获取SSL证书请求文件
首先,你需要生成一个SSL证书请求文件(CSR)。这可以通过你的服务器管理界面或者通过命令行工具来完成。以Apache为例
```bash openssl req new newkey rsa:2048 nodes out server.csr keyout server.key ```
这个命令会创建一个新的私钥和一个证书签名请求文件。
步骤二 提交证书请求
接下来,将生成的CSR文件发送给CA(证书颁发机构),如Let's Encrypt。你可以通过他们的官方平台在线提交请求,填写必要的域名信息和联系信息即可。
步骤三 等待审核并通过支付费用
通常情况下,免费的SSL证书需要经过一定的审核流程才能获得批准。一旦审核通过,你会收到一封包含下载链接的电子邮件。
步骤四 下载SSL证书
点击邮件中的下载链接,选择合适的格式(通常是`.crt`)保存到本地计算机上。
网站安装SSL证书麻烦吗?
虽然整个过程可能看起来有些繁琐,但实际上并不难。只要按照上述步骤操作,大多数人都能顺利完成安装。以下是具体的安装步骤
步骤五 配置Nginx服务器
假设你已经有了Nginx服务器,打开其配置文件(通常是`/etc/nginx/sitesavailable/default`),找到如下一行

```nginx server { listen 443 ssl; ... } ```
在这段代码后面添加SSL相关的配置
```nginx sslcertificate /path/to/your/certificate.crt; sslcertificatekey /path/to/your/private.key; sslprotocols TLSv1.2 TLSv1.3; sslciphers 'ECDHEECDSAAES128GCMSHA256:ECDHERSAAES128GCMSHA256...'; ```
替换`/path/to/your/`为实际的路径。
步骤六 重启Nginx服务
完成配置后,运行以下命令重启Nginx服务以确保更改生效
```bash sudo systemctl restart nginx ```
或者根据你的系统环境使用相应的命令。
使用场景
无论你的网站是个人博客、企业官网还是电子商务平台,安装SSL证书都是保障用户信息安全的基本措施。这不仅有助于提高用户的信任感,还能防止数据泄露和网络攻击。
完整的教程步骤
生成CSR文件 使用命令行工具生成CSR文件。
提交证书请求 在线提交CSR文件给CA。
下载SSL证书 收到邮件后下载证书文件。
配置Nginx 编辑Nginx配置文件并添加SSL设置。
重启服务 重新启动Nginx服务使更改生效。
结语
尽管安装SSL证书的过程看似复杂,但遵循正确的步骤,任何人都可以轻松完成这一任务。为了更好地保护网站和数据的安全,建议尽快进行SSL证书的安装工作。记住,安全无小事,每一个小细节都可能关系到整个网站的稳定和安全。如果你遇到任何问题,欢迎随时向我咨询。祝你顺利!
以上内容仅供参考,实际操作时请根据具体情况调整。如有疑问,请联系技术支持团队获取帮助。

评论